Advances in Blockchain and IoT Applications for Secure, Transparent, and Scalable Digital Financial Transactions

Abstract:
This paper explores the convergence of Blockchain and Internet of Things (IoT) technologies and their transformative potential in digital financial transactions. With the rise of decentralized systems, blockchain provides a secure, transparent, and immutable ledger for recording financial transactions, while IoT enables real-time data collection and automation in financial networks. The integration of these two technologies offers enhanced scalability, security, and efficiency, significantly improving the performance of digital financial systems. However, the combination of blockchain and IoT introduces new challenges, including security vulnerabilities, privacy concerns, and the need for effective mitigation strategies. The paper highlights key trends, such as the rise of smart contracts, tokenization, decentralized finance (DeFi) applications, and the incorporation of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) to optimize blockchain-IoT ecosystems. It also examines the evolving regulatory and ethical considerations for these hybrid systems. As these technologies continue to mature, understanding their potential and addressing their associated risks will be critical for the future of digital financial transactions.
